Clearwater Beach Fishing Report – Christmas Week December 2025

Group of anglers holding red snapper on a dock at Clearwater Beach Marina, Florida

Christmas week fishing around Clearwater Beach is active and weather-driven. This is one of the busier periods of the winter season, with visiting anglers, full charter schedules, and fish that continue feeding despite cooler water temperatures.

Cold fronts shape the rhythm of the week, but they do not shut fishing down. When winds settle after a front and water clarity improves, action turns on quickly. Productive trips come from choosing the right zone for the day rather than committing to a fixed plan.

During this period, fishing ranges from protected inshore waters to short nearshore runs when conditions allow. Offshore trips are possible, but they depend on narrow weather windows between fronts.

Inshore fishing during Christmas week

Inshore fishing remains reliable throughout Christmas week, especially inside Clearwater Harbor, along the Intracoastal Waterway, and near the protected shorelines of Caladesi Island.

Redfish hold tight to mangroves, docks, and deeper edges where water temperature stays stable. Spotted seatrout shift into deeper holes, channel bends, and bay edges following cold fronts, then move shallower again as conditions improve. Snook activity slows, but fish remain present in deeper residential canals and dock-heavy areas during warming trends.

Inshore trips typically involve minimal running and are often the most consistent option during unsettled weather.

Nearshore fishing distance and structure

When seas allow, nearshore fishing becomes a strong option during Christmas week. Most nearshore trips out of Clearwater Beach involve runs of roughly 5 to 15 miles, focusing on hard bottom and artificial reef structure west of Clearwater Pass.

Sheepshead, hogfish, and mangrove snapper hold tight to structure, especially during stable weather periods. Water clarity is critical this time of year. After north winds, fish stack closer to the bottom and respond best to slow, vertical presentations. When clarity improves, nearshore fishing can be productive even if conditions only hold for a single day.

These trips offer a good balance between opportunity and weather exposure during late December.

Offshore fishing expectations and range

Offshore fishing during Christmas week is possible but selective. Offshore runs typically extend beyond nearshore structure and require longer runs that depend entirely on spacing between cold fronts.

When the Gulf settles, deeper ledges and hard bottom west of Clearwater can produce quality grouper and snapper. This is not a time for exploratory offshore fishing. Successful trips focus on known structure, efficient drifts, and clear targets.


Short, well-timed offshore runs consistently outperform longer trips during this period.

Weather, pressure, and timing

Cold fronts move through regularly during late December. Rapid temperature drops can slow fish activity temporarily, particularly inshore, but fish rebound quickly once conditions stabilize.

Clear water often follows fronts, improving visibility and bite quality inshore and nearshore. Holiday boat traffic is heavier, which makes early starts and off-peak timing more important than distance traveled.


Anglers who remain flexible and adjust plans daily see the best results.

Christmas week fishing around Clearwater Beach rewards experience and local knowledge. Understanding which areas stabilize first after fronts, when nearshore structure is worth the run, and when offshore trips are realistic can make a significant difference.
